Namyangho Lake (Namyanghwangra)

Namyanghwangra is an area where 1,211ha of reclaimed farmland was formed upon the completion of the 2,065m Namyang Embankment on December 20, 1973. Namyangho Lake, an artificial lake created alongside the embankment construction, spans 967ha and is a tourist attraction designated as one of Hwaseong's Eight Scenic Spots. Rice produced in the Namyang reclaimed land contains high alkaline content, boasting the best quality among Gyeonggi rice. The vast fields offer different seasonal abundance, but especially the golden fields in autumn harmonize with Namyangho Lake, adding richness and fullness. In winter, it becomes an excellent habitat for bean geese seeking plant-based food. In the fields that once formed golden waves in autumn, bean geese gather in flocks, and mallards settle near Jangan Bridge. By parking on the roadside and simply opening the window, winter migratory birds can be observed without special equipment. It is also famous for ice fishing in winter. At the entrance of Namyang Embankment, the left side is Namyangho Lake and the right side is the sea, making it a unique spot where both the sea and the lake can be seen at once.
